Position Summary
This course surveys the history of art and visual culture from prehistoric times to the present. Taking a global perspective, students discover key moments in the development of human creativity, which continue to shape our understanding of the material, historical, and social importance of art in the present day.Position Requirements The successful candidate will possess at minimum a MA in Art History or be in the process of completing such a degree. PhDs in Art History or related critical and theoretical disciplines are encouraged to apply. Candidates who hold MFAs in Visual Arts or current MFA students in Visual Arts with extensive art historical experience, such as peer-reviewed publications, presentations, or curatorial projects, may be considered.
University teaching experience is preferred.
